Project Name: Stafford County Public Safety Building
Location: Stafford County, VA
Owner: Stafford County
Designer: unknown
Project Budget: $41,400,000
Brief Description:

Downey & Scott provided construction management services including pre-construction PPEA evaluation, value engineering, cost management, as well as project and program management during the pre through post construction phases of this design-build project.  

This 119,000 GSF project included the integration of state-of-the-art 911 systems as well as radio systems, security systems, computer network systems, and the emergency dispatch center’s equipment and furniture. This project came in on-time and under budget with zero change orders, and no claims.

The budget included all technology integration, hard and soft construction costs, and seven (7) acres of site development. Our value engineering study yielded 24 recommendations and 7 design suggestions, which saved the owner approximately $1,000,000.  Additionally we were able to identify areas, during the design phase, of minor cost to yield maximum results for Stafford County and have unfinished space included as part of the base building design that would allow for future growth over the next twenty years.

Downey & Scott coordinated with the Army Corps of Engineers, Stafford County Building Officials, and the Design Team to expedite permits and the flow of information regarding sensitive wetlands and the Corp of Engineers permitting.
